Navan, Ontario
Located on a main thoroughfare in front of the
Navan Memorial Centre some 50 km east of downtown
Ottawa. Constructed on June 28, 1987, in memory
of Navan Veterans by Navan Veterans and Friends.
The Navan Memorial Cenotaph Committee was
headed by Herb Deavy, a local veteran, which was
successful in raising the necessary funds from
private donations. Veterans Affairs Minister, the
Hon. George Hees, present at the dedication,
commented that it was a great effort and didn't
cost the taxpayers a cent. The story was printed
in the Orleans Express, now The Star, on July 1,
1987. Herb has a great scrapbook and video which
he will leave to an appropriate local institution
for posterity.
